Phishing scams have become one of the most common and damaging forms of online fraud today.

With criminals using text messages, emails, and apps like WhatsApp to impersonate trusted institutions, countless people are being lured into clicking on malicious links that look legitimate but lead to devastating consequences. Victims often lose sensitive personal information or even their life savings within minutes.
